Background
An ink agitator is a device for agitating viscous materials such as ink, and is operated to agitate and mix them uniformly by rotating a shaft with blades in a cylinder or a tank. Most of the stirring devices on the market are heavy and difficult to carry, and are not easy to control, the function is single, the height of a stirring rod and a stirring blade can not be adjusted by a plurality of devices, so the stirring rod and the stirring blade can be easily and carelessly touched and scratch workers when pouring ink, secondly, the cleaning of the blades is not convenient, most of the stirring devices can fix a stirring pot or a groove, but the pot is required to be taken down to pour out the ink when pouring the ink, some stirring pots are very heavy and inconvenient.

Detailed Description
The preferred embodiments of the present invention will be described in conjunction with the accompanying drawings, and it will be understood that they are presented herein only to illustrate and explain the present invention, and not to limit the present invention.
Examples
As shown in figures 1-4, the utility model provides a color printing ink stirring device, which comprises a device body 1, the device body 1 comprises a base 2, universal wheels 3, side plates 4, a handle 5, a bearing plate 6, a stirring motor 7, an output shaft 8, stirring blades 9, a stirring pot 10, an ink outlet 11 and a rotating rod 12, the base 2 is arranged at the bottom of the device body 1, the universal wheels 3 are arranged at four corners of the bottom of the base 2, the top of the universal wheels 3 is connected with the bottom of the base 2 through bolt threads, the side plate 4 is arranged at the top of one side of the base 2, the handle 5 is arranged at the top of the side plate 4, the handle 5 is fixedly connected with the side plate 4 through argon arc welding, the bearing plate 6 is arranged at one side of the side plate 4, the stirring motor 7 is arranged at the top of the bearing plate 6, the bottom of the stirring motor 7 is connected with the, the top of output shaft 8 runs through in loading board 6 and agitator motor 7 fixed connection, the bottom of output shaft 8 is equipped with stirring vane 9, the top of base 2 is equipped with agitator kettle 10, the both sides of agitator kettle 10 all are equipped with dwang 12, the U type rotation groove 13 has all been opened on the inboard both sides of base 2, agitator kettle 10 rotates through dwang 12 and U type rotation groove 13 with base 2 and is connected, the inboard top of base 2 is equipped with two fixed clamp splice 14, one side top of base 2 is equipped with control panel 15.
Further, the inside of curb plate 4 is equipped with first lead screw 16, the inside of base 2 is equipped with first lead screw motor 17, the bottom of curb plate 4 and the top of base 2 are dug there is the through-hole, the bottom of first lead screw 16 runs through in curb plate 4 and base 2 and is connected with first lead screw motor 17 through first belt 18 rotation, the screw is carved with on the surface of first lead screw 16, threaded hole is dug to one side of loading board 6, loading board 6 carries out threaded connection through screw and threaded hole with first lead screw 16, be convenient for control agitator motor 7's height.
Furthermore, a second screw rod 19 is arranged inside the base 2, a second screw rod motor 20 is arranged on one side inside the base 2, the second screw rod 19 and the second screw rod motor 20 are rotatably connected through a second belt 21, the second screw rod 19 is formed by splicing two threaded rods with opposite thread directions, a threaded hole is formed in the bottom of the fixed clamping block 14 in a chiseled mode, the fixed clamping block 14 is in threaded connection with the two ends of the second screw rod 19 through the threaded hole, and therefore gathering and separation of the fixed clamping block 14 are controlled conveniently.
Furthermore, an ink outlet 11 is formed in one side of the stirring pot 10, so that ink can be poured out conveniently.
Further, base 2 and 4 insides of curb plate are hollow structure, and the use material is the stainless steel, and is whole more light, and intensity is high.
Furthermore, a rubber handle sleeve is arranged above the handle 5, so that the rubber handle sleeve is convenient to grip and prevent slipping and falling off.
Further, the stirring motor 7, the first screw rod motor 17 and the second screw rod motor 20 are electrically connected with the control panel 15, so that the structure is compact and the operation is convenient.
Specifically, when using the utility model discloses the time, the printing ink that will need the stirring after confirming clean no debris in the agitator kettle 10 is poured into wherein, adjust the angle assurance level of agitator kettle 10 after and draw close tight agitator kettle 10 to the center through control panel 15 control fixed clamp splice 14, wait fully to press from both sides and tightly through control panel 15 control loading board 6 slow decline after agitator kettle 10 does not rock, treat that stirring vane 9 abundant submergence can in printing ink, open agitator motor 7's switch and let it drive output shaft 8 and stirring vane 9 rotatory, and then the printing ink that drives agitator kettle 10 rotates, treat that the printing ink stirring that needs the stirring stops agitator motor 7's work after abundant, rise loading board 6, separate fixed clamp splice 14 to both sides, then accessible dwang 12 rotates agitator kettle 10, pour the printing ink that finishes the stirring into in the splendid attire container.
